PIR (Passive Infrared) detectors play a crucial role in security systems. They are designed to sense changes in infrared radiation, which humans emit. When an individual moves within their detection range, the PIR sensor detects the heat difference. This basic principle allows for effective motion detection.
Understanding the functionality of PIR detectors is essential for their proper application. Most detectors have a range of around 20 to 30 feet, depending on the lens design. The detectors can be used in various settings, from home security systems to large commercial buildings. However, positioning can affect their effectiveness. Proper placement is key.
Common challenges include false alarms caused by pets or moving trees. Environmental factors like temperature and humidity can also impact performance. Calibration is sometimes necessary for optimal effectiveness. Users should consider frequent maintenance checks to ensure reliability. Passive Infrared (PIR) detectors are a popular choice for security systems. They work by detecting changes in infrared radiation. This makes them effective for identifying human movement. Unlike other motion sensors, PIR detectors are less prone to false alarms. They can differentiate between human heat and other heat sources. This specificity enhances their reliability in various environments.
Other types of motion sensors include ultrasonic and microwave sensors. Ultrasonic sensors emit sound waves and measure their reflection. They can cover larger areas but may trigger from objects like pets. Microwave sensors use radio waves and can penetrate objects. However, they can be affected by obstacles and may require calibration. Each type has its strengths and weaknesses.
PIR detectors require installation with attention to placement. Misalignment can result in decreased performance. Understanding the environment is crucial. The field of view, temperature changes, and potential obstructions must be considered. This awareness can enhance security measures, leading to more effective solutions. Installing PIR (Passive Infrared) detectors can significantly enhance security measures. However, optimizing their performance requires careful consideration and strategic placement. Choose locations with minimal obstructions. Trees or furniture can block detection areas. This can lead to missed signals or false alarms.
When setting up, consider the detection angle. Most PIR detectors have a 110-degree coverage. Placing devices too high may cause blind spots. Aim for a height of about 6 to 8 feet. This height maximizes coverage while minimizing the potential for false triggers from animals.
Additionally, ensure the detectors are shielded from direct sunlight. Sun exposure can create heat fluctuations that interfere with accuracy. Regular testing of devices is crucial.
